A Conversation with My Father Discussion/Analysis Prompt

What is the role of humor and “jokes,” a term the father uses in discussing the writer’s tale and the real world, in the story? What does the father’s use of this term reveal about him?

Teaching Suggestion: The father’s use of the term “jokes” in reference to the story and real life helps the reader understand his perspective on literature, life, and tragedy. Students can use this connection between the creation of a character and a view of life and literature to develop their understanding of characterization as a means of addressing larger themes in literature.

Differentiation Suggestion: Students who find it difficult to organize their thinking or those with executive function challenges may benefit from a graphic organizer that helps them track the father’s references to jokes, the context in which he makes them, and how each reference teaches the reader more about the father. Additionally, students may benefit from sentence starters or sentence frames to prepare their ideas for the discussion.
